IGF-1 Trajectory Management is the clinical practice of monitoring and strategically influencing the concentration of Insulin-like Growth Factor 1 (IGF-1) over time to maintain optimal levels for tissue health and longevity. IGF-1, a peptide hormone primarily produced in the liver in response to Growth Hormone (GH), mediates many of GH’s anabolic effects. Management focuses on balancing its regenerative benefits against the potential risks associated with excessively high or low long-term levels.
Origin
The concept is rooted in the neuroendocrinology of the Growth Hormone/IGF-1 axis and its well-established role in human development and aging. Trajectory emphasizes the longitudinal pattern of concentration, acknowledging that IGF-1 naturally declines with age. Management denotes the active clinical intervention to steer this decline toward a healthy, sustained course.
Mechanism
The liver releases IGF-1 upon stimulation by pulsatile GH secretion, and IGF-1 then acts systemically as a potent anabolic and anti-apoptotic factor. Management involves carefully adjusting lifestyle factors or GH-secretagogues to optimize the GH pulse amplitude and frequency. This fine-tuning ensures sufficient IGF-1 for muscle protein synthesis, bone turnover, and cognitive function without promoting adverse cellular proliferation.
